新聞中心
在C語(yǔ)言中加入圖片并不像在某些高級(jí)語(yǔ)言(如Python、Java)中那樣直接,C語(yǔ)言本身并沒(méi)有內(nèi)建的圖形庫(kù)來(lái)處理圖像,因此我們需要借助第三方庫(kù)來(lái)實(shí)現(xiàn)這一功能,一個(gè)常用的庫(kù)是EasyX圖形庫(kù),它是針對(duì)C語(yǔ)言初學(xué)者設(shè)計(jì)的一個(gè)簡(jiǎn)單易用的圖形庫(kù)。

專(zhuān)注于為中小企業(yè)提供成都網(wǎng)站制作、成都網(wǎng)站設(shè)計(jì)服務(wù),電腦端+手機(jī)端+微信端的三站合一,更高效的管理,為中小企業(yè)潞城免費(fèi)做網(wǎng)站提供優(yōu)質(zhì)的服務(wù)。我們立足成都,凝聚了一批互聯(lián)網(wǎng)行業(yè)人才,有力地推動(dòng)了成百上千家企業(yè)的穩(wěn)健成長(zhǎng),幫助中小企業(yè)通過(guò)網(wǎng)站建設(shè)實(shí)現(xiàn)規(guī)模擴(kuò)充和轉(zhuǎn)變。
以下是使用EasyX圖形庫(kù)在C語(yǔ)言中加載和顯示圖片的步驟:
1、安裝EasyX圖形庫(kù)
你需要下載并安裝EasyX圖形庫(kù),你可以從官方網(wǎng)站或者其他資源網(wǎng)站下載,下載后,按照說(shuō)明進(jìn)行安裝。
2、配置開(kāi)發(fā)環(huán)境
安裝完成后,需要在你的開(kāi)發(fā)環(huán)境中配置EasyX圖形庫(kù),這通常涉及到設(shè)置包含文件的路徑和鏈接庫(kù)的路徑。
3、編寫(xiě)代碼
接下來(lái),你可以開(kāi)始編寫(xiě)代碼來(lái)加載和顯示圖片,以下是一個(gè)簡(jiǎn)單的示例:
解析:
我們包含了graphics.h頭文件,這是EasyX圖形庫(kù)的主要頭文件。
我們?cè)?code>main函數(shù)中使用initgraph函數(shù)初始化圖形模式,這個(gè)函數(shù)需要一個(gè)參數(shù),表示圖形窗口的大小。initgraph(640, 480)將創(chuàng)建一個(gè)640×480像素的窗口。
接著,我們使用loadimage函數(shù)加載圖片,這個(gè)函數(shù)需要兩個(gè)參數(shù):一個(gè)是圖片的地址,另一個(gè)是一個(gè)IMAGE類(lèi)型的指針,用于存儲(chǔ)加載的圖片。
我們使用putimage函數(shù)將圖片顯示在窗口上。
代碼:
“`c
#include
#include
int main()
{
// 初始化圖形模式
initgraph(640, 480);
// 加載圖片
IMAGE img;
loadimage(&img, _T("path_to_your_image.jpg"));
// 顯示圖片
putimage(0, 0, &img);
// 按任意鍵退出
getch();
closegraph();
return 0;
}
“`
注意:請(qǐng)將path_to_your_image.jpg替換為你的圖片文件的實(shí)際路徑。
4、編譯和運(yùn)行
保存你的代碼,然后使用支持EasyX圖形庫(kù)的編譯器(如Visual C++)編譯和運(yùn)行你的程序,你應(yīng)該能看到一個(gè)窗口,其中顯示了你的圖片。
5、注意事項(xiàng)
請(qǐng)確保你的圖片文件格式被EasyX圖形庫(kù)支持,EasyX支持常見(jiàn)的圖片格式,如JPG、BMP等。
如果你的圖片文件和你的代碼不在同一目錄下,你需要提供完整的文件路徑。
在Windows環(huán)境下,路徑字符串前需要加上_T宏,以支持Unicode字符。
以上就是在C語(yǔ)言中加入圖片的基本步驟,希望對(duì)你有所幫助!
網(wǎng)頁(yè)題目:c語(yǔ)言怎么加入圖片
標(biāo)題來(lái)源:http://m.5511xx.com/article/coeecgc.html


咨詢(xún)
建站咨詢(xún)
